Quake drill postponed due to ‘National Day of Protest’

File Photo : DND Secretary Delfin Lorenzana

MANILA — Defense Secretary Delfin Lorenzana on Tuesday announced the postponement of the 3rd Quarter National Simultaneous Earthquake Drill (NSED) which was earlier scheduled to be held in Bacoor City, Cavite on Sept. 21.

This is in wake of President Rodrigo Duterte’s decision to declare the said date as a “National Day of Protest” and announced the suspension of government work and classes in public schools.

The ceremonial venue was supposed to be at the Strike Gymnasium, 2 p.m. this Thursday.

Since most of the Regional Disaster Risk Reduction and Management (DRRM) Councils have selected government offices and schools as pilot areas, the NDRRMC deemed it necessary to conduct the 3rd quarter NSED to a later date.

“This is to ensure maximum participation to the earthquake drill,” Lorenzana, concurrent National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Council (NDRRMC) chair, said in a statement.

The new schedule of the 3rd quarter NSED is yet to be determined, he added.

The NDRRMC conducts Nationwide Earthquake Drills quarterly, as one of the tools to promote disaster preparedness and resilience among communities. (PNA)
